Skip to main content

Top Data Analyst Interview Questions

Review this list of 123 Data Analyst interview questions and answers verified by hiring managers and candidates.
  • Stripe logoAsked at Stripe 
    1 answer

    "Stripe Connect is the backbone for marketplaces and platforms like think Shopify, DoorDash, or Lyft, that need to send money to multiple sellers or service providers. Its core promise is simple but vital: enable platforms to pay their users quickly, reliably, and compliantly. If we step back, a good North Star Metric should reflect the real value the product delivers to its users, and it should scale as that value grows. For Connect, that value is the flow of money from platforms to their conne"

    Christopher W. - "Stripe Connect is the backbone for marketplaces and platforms like think Shopify, DoorDash, or Lyft, that need to send money to multiple sellers or service providers. Its core promise is simple but vital: enable platforms to pay their users quickly, reliably, and compliantly. If we step back, a good North Star Metric should reflect the real value the product delivers to its users, and it should scale as that value grows. For Connect, that value is the flow of money from platforms to their conne"See full answer

    Data Analyst
    Analytical
  • 1 answer

    "When a stakeholder’s request is ambiguous, I start by clarifying the goal and defining what “success” looks like. I ask targeted questions to understand the business problem, the timeframe, the scope/location, and who the analysis is for. Then I confirm definitions (metrics, segments, filters), agree on the expected output format, and restate the request back to them in one sentence before I begin."

    Kevin T. - "When a stakeholder’s request is ambiguous, I start by clarifying the goal and defining what “success” looks like. I ask targeted questions to understand the business problem, the timeframe, the scope/location, and who the analysis is for. Then I confirm definitions (metrics, segments, filters), agree on the expected output format, and restate the request back to them in one sentence before I begin."See full answer

    Data Analyst
    Data Analysis
    +2 more
  • "We want to use rigorous framework for evaluating shipping a new feature — ideally an A/B test. If an A/B test is not available, we first evaluate quantitative data; we look at feature adoption metrics, time-to-use, retention and frequency of visitation. What does the business impact of the feature on conversion rates, revenue per users and LTV, and secondarily evaluate any error rates that could be occurring after the launch of the new feature. It’s important for this analysis to perform segmen"

    Katherine B. - "We want to use rigorous framework for evaluating shipping a new feature — ideally an A/B test. If an A/B test is not available, we first evaluate quantitative data; we look at feature adoption metrics, time-to-use, retention and frequency of visitation. What does the business impact of the feature on conversion rates, revenue per users and LTV, and secondarily evaluate any error rates that could be occurring after the launch of the new feature. It’s important for this analysis to perform segmen"See full answer

    Data Analyst
    Data Analysis
    +2 more
  • 4 answers

    " import pandas as pd import numpy as np def findoverstretchedemployees(departments: pd.DataFrame, employees: pd.DataFrame, projects: pd.DataFrame, employees_projects: pd.DataFrame) -> pd.DataFrame: Make a copy to avoid modifying original dataframe projects = projects.copy() Convert dates to datetime projects["startdate"] = pd.todatetime(projects["start_date""

    Diyorbek T. - " import pandas as pd import numpy as np def findoverstretchedemployees(departments: pd.DataFrame, employees: pd.DataFrame, projects: pd.DataFrame, employees_projects: pd.DataFrame) -> pd.DataFrame: Make a copy to avoid modifying original dataframe projects = projects.copy() Convert dates to datetime projects["startdate"] = pd.todatetime(projects["start_date""See full answer

    Data Analyst
    Coding
    +1 more
  • Microsoft logoAsked at Microsoft 
    2 answers

    "SQL stands for Structured Query Language. It’s a standard programming language used to manage and manipulate relational databases. "

    Adam M. - "SQL stands for Structured Query Language. It’s a standard programming language used to manage and manipulate relational databases. "See full answer

    Data Analyst
    SQL
    +2 more
  • 🧠 Want an expert answer to a question? Saving questions lets us know what content to make next.

  • "At one of my project, I worked on a project where we needed to collect data from different sections of a large factory and deliver it to a third-party company responsible for predictive analytics on product quality and production levels. The challenge was that each department had different data types and structures, and in many cases, direct connections were restricted due to strict security policies. My responsibility was to design and implement a solution that could gather all these heterogene"

    Maryam G. - "At one of my project, I worked on a project where we needed to collect data from different sections of a large factory and deliver it to a third-party company responsible for predictive analytics on product quality and production levels. The challenge was that each department had different data types and structures, and in many cases, direct connections were restricted due to strict security policies. My responsibility was to design and implement a solution that could gather all these heterogene"See full answer

    Data Analyst
    Data Analysis
    +2 more
  • Zomato logoAsked at Zomato 
    2 answers

    "Thankyou for asking me this answer. What makes me unique in data analytics is my ability to blend technical skills with a strong business mindset. I don’t just focus on building dashboards or running analyses-I always tie the insights back to real business impact. During my internship at Quantara Analytics, for example, I didn’t just track supplier KPI's. I redesigned the reporting process, which cut manual work by 60% and improved decision-making. I’m also proactive about learning tools like Po"

    Dhruv M. - "Thankyou for asking me this answer. What makes me unique in data analytics is my ability to blend technical skills with a strong business mindset. I don’t just focus on building dashboards or running analyses-I always tie the insights back to real business impact. During my internship at Quantara Analytics, for example, I didn’t just track supplier KPI's. I redesigned the reporting process, which cut manual work by 60% and improved decision-making. I’m also proactive about learning tools like Po"See full answer

    Data Analyst
    Behavioral
  • Atlassian logoAsked at Atlassian 
    Add answer
    Data Analyst
    Behavioral
    +7 more
  • Data Analyst
    Data Analysis
    +2 more
  • 2 answers

    "If we’re using an A/B test we have a few decision criteria that we can use to measure success. If our primary metric has been shown to be statistically significant (and our confidence interval does not cross 0), and the gaurdrail metrics that we created have not been negatively affected, we should consider shipping. If the our p-value is not significant we can still consider shipping beta if the guardrail metrics have not been negatively affected, and we weigh the opportunity cost of not shippin"

    Katherine B. - "If we’re using an A/B test we have a few decision criteria that we can use to measure success. If our primary metric has been shown to be statistically significant (and our confidence interval does not cross 0), and the gaurdrail metrics that we created have not been negatively affected, we should consider shipping. If the our p-value is not significant we can still consider shipping beta if the guardrail metrics have not been negatively affected, and we weigh the opportunity cost of not shippin"See full answer

    Data Analyst
    Data Analysis
    +3 more
  • "line/ trend charts are the simplest method to identify churn "

    Archit G. - "line/ trend charts are the simplest method to identify churn "See full answer

    Data Analyst
    Data Analysis
    +2 more
  • HelloFresh logoAsked at HelloFresh 
    2 answers

    "Something not mentioned in my resume is my hobbies. I have a strong interest in analyzing situations, which I enjoy as a mental exercise. I'm also skilled at painting and have a passion for reading books, which helps me broaden my perspective."

    Manaswini D. - "Something not mentioned in my resume is my hobbies. I have a strong interest in analyzing situations, which I enjoy as a mental exercise. I'm also skilled at painting and have a passion for reading books, which helps me broaden my perspective."See full answer

    Data Analyst
    Behavioral
    +1 more
  • "breakdown the questions from Top- Down or sum up from bottom-ip Identify KPI and North star metrics Identify and analyze cohorts and segments Transform data to actionable insights"

    George P. - "breakdown the questions from Top- Down or sum up from bottom-ip Identify KPI and North star metrics Identify and analyze cohorts and segments Transform data to actionable insights"See full answer

    Data Analyst
    Data Analysis
    +2 more
  • Add answer
    Data Analyst
    Data Analysis
    +2 more
  • Data Analyst
    Data Analysis
    +2 more
  • 1 answer

    "We have detailed monitoring and meetings dedicated to discussing the health of the conversion business. When I’ve seen drops in the conversion rate, the first thing I do to diagnose the issue is to work backwards through the conversion funnel. For example, if I see a drop in user adoption rates, I will evaluate if there are any product experiments that could be negatively affecting adoption. Likewise, was there a technical outage that could have caused a drop? Segmentation and cohorting is also"

    Katherine B. - "We have detailed monitoring and meetings dedicated to discussing the health of the conversion business. When I’ve seen drops in the conversion rate, the first thing I do to diagnose the issue is to work backwards through the conversion funnel. For example, if I see a drop in user adoption rates, I will evaluate if there are any product experiments that could be negatively affecting adoption. Likewise, was there a technical outage that could have caused a drop? Segmentation and cohorting is also"See full answer

    Data Analyst
    Data Analysis
    +2 more
  • Data Analyst
    Data Analysis
    +2 more
  • 1 answer

    "For ROI for strategic bets, we want to evaluate short term and long-term returns on our investment as well as ensuring we have quantitative and qualitative milestones to measure progress towards the long-term goal. For quantitative evaluation, I would first outline resource investment from upfront capital investment, infrastructure resourcing and clearly capture the opportunity cost of the investment. Then I would set leading success indicators, and business metrics over the timeline of the inv"

    Katherine B. - "For ROI for strategic bets, we want to evaluate short term and long-term returns on our investment as well as ensuring we have quantitative and qualitative milestones to measure progress towards the long-term goal. For quantitative evaluation, I would first outline resource investment from upfront capital investment, infrastructure resourcing and clearly capture the opportunity cost of the investment. Then I would set leading success indicators, and business metrics over the timeline of the inv"See full answer

    Data Analyst
    Data Analysis
    +2 more
  • Add answer
    Data Analyst
    Data Analysis
    +2 more
  • Data Analyst
    Data Analysis
    +2 more
Showing 61-80 of 123